The Barnegat Morning Report: Quakers Talk, An Author Interview And Kyle McGetrick Benefit

Good morning, Barnegat! Today is Tuesday, May 15.

 

We hope you will read our preview article about the local Quakers hosting a discussion about the federal budget.

Later on today, we are previewing a children's author visit to the Barnegat Library. Deborah Guarino, author of the well-known rhyming picture book "Is Your Mama A Llama," is coming to sign copies in town on Thursday night.

Finally, we will share information on another event in memory of Kyle McGetrick, a "Courage From Kyle" fundraiser that is being organized by young people at the Barnegat High School.

EVENTS AND REMINDERS:

Tonight the Barnegat Board of Education will hold its regular monthly meeting at the Barnegat High School auditorium at 6:30 p.m.

The Barnegat Historical Society will be hosting an open house today, May 15th at 7:30 p.m. at our Heritage Village on East Bay Avenue. The village houses a wonderful collection of furnishings, tools, and artifacts donated from local families. This event is free and open to all. Light refreshments will be served.
